Double-stranded RNA activates a p38 MAPK-dependent cell survival program in biliary epithelia

Laura Tadlock1, Yoko Yamagiwa, Carla Marienfeld

  • 1Scott and White Clinic, Texas A&M University System Health Science Center, College of Medicine, Temple, Texas 76508, USA.

Summary

Double-stranded RNA (dsRNA) activates a cell-survival pathway in biliary cells. This p38 MAPK-dependent pathway may influence responses to viral infections or DNA damage.
